一种发动机喷油量计算方法及装置的制作方法

文档序号:6579376阅读:878来源:国知局
专利名称:一种发动机喷油量计算方法及装置的制作方法
技术领域
本发明涉及机械控制领域,尤其是涉及一种发动机喷油量计算方法及装置。
背景技术
扭矩/油量转换MAP图为横坐标为发动机转速,纵坐标为需求扭矩,转速和需求扭矩对应特定的喷油量的三维图。在国II1、国IV电控发动机中,对喷油量的标定方式通常是根据发动机的当前转速和当前需求扭矩,以及扭矩/油量转换MAP图计算出对应的喷油量。但是,目前的现有技术中,当发动机当前需求扭矩小于扭矩/油量转换MAP图中的最小的标定扭矩时,则按扭矩/油量转换MAP图中最小的标定扭矩对应的喷油量喷油,此时由于喷油量过多,很容易出现发动机怠速不稳的现象;当发动机当前需求扭矩大于扭矩/油量转换MAP图中最大的标定扭矩时,则按扭矩/油量转换MAP图中最大的标定扭矩对应的喷油量喷油,此时由于喷油量过少,易导致发动机熄火。

发明内容
本发明解决的技术问题在于提供一种发动机喷油量计算方法及装置,从而能够在发动机当前需求扭矩不在扭矩/油量转换MAP图的扭矩标定范围内时,提供更合理的喷油量计算方式,从而改善易出现的发动机怠速不稳或发动机熄火的问题。为此,本发明解决技术问题的技术方案是本发明提供了一种发动机喷油量计算方法,所述方法包括计算发动机当前需求扭矩;判断所述当前需求扭矩是否小于扭矩/油量转换MAP图的最小标定扭矩,或者大于扭矩/油量转换MAP图的最大标定扭矩,如果是,则根据扭矩/油量转换MAP图中两点的需求扭矩和喷油量的对应关系,利用正相关线性算法计算出当前需求扭矩对应的喷油量;其中,所述两点中的一点为与当前需求扭矩最近的标定扭矩。优选地,当Ns < Nml时,所述利用正相关线性算法计算出的当前需求扭矩对应的喷油量Ps
权利要求
1.一种发动机喷油量计算方法,其特征在于,所述方法包括 计算发动机当前需求扭矩; 判断所述当前需求扭矩是否小于扭矩/油量转换MAP图的最小标定扭矩,或者大于扭矩/油量转换MAP图的最大标定扭矩,如果是,则根据扭矩/油量转换MAP图中两点的需求扭矩和喷油量的对应关系,利用正相关线性算法计算出当前需求扭矩对应的喷油量;其中,所述两点中的一点为与当前需求扭矩最近的标定扭矩。
2.根据权利要求1所述的方法,其特征在于, 当Ns < Nml时,所述利用正相关线性算法计算出的当前需求扭矩对应的喷油量Ps应 为
3.根据权利要求1所述的方法,其特征在于,所述正相关线性算法具体为线性插值算法。
4.根据权利要求3所述的方法,其特征在于,当Ns< Nml时,所述利用正相关线性算法计算出的当前需求扭矩对应的喷油量Ps应为
5.根据权利要求3所述的方法,其特征在于,所述扭矩/油量转换MAP图中的两点具体为 扭矩/油量转换MAP图中与当前需求扭矩最近的标定扭矩,以及与所述最近的标定扭矩的扭矩差值等于所述最近的标定扭矩与当前需求扭矩的差值的一点。
6.根据权利要求1所述的方法,其特征在于,所述判断所述当前需求扭矩是否小于扭矩/油量转换MAP图的最小标定扭矩,或者大于扭矩/油量转换MAP图的最大标定扭矩的判断结果为否时,根据扭矩/油量转换MAP图计算出当前需求扭矩对应的喷油量。
7.根据权利要求1所述的方法,其特征在于,所述判断所述当前需求扭矩是否小于扭矩/油量转换MAP图的最小标定扭矩,或者大于扭矩/油量转换MAP图的最大标定扭矩具体为 判断所述当前需求扭矩是否不大于第一极值,或者不小于第二极值;其中,所述第一极值为导致发动机怠速不稳的临界扭矩,所述第一极值小于扭矩/油量转换MAP图的最小标定扭矩;所述第二极值为导致发动机熄火的临界扭矩,所述第二极值大于扭矩/油量转换MAP图的最大标定扭矩。
8.根据权利要求1所述的方法,其特征在于,在利用正相关线性算法计算出当前需求扭矩对应的喷油量之后还包括 根据计算出的对应的喷油量进行喷油; 所述方法还包括以预设周期循环执行所述计算发动机当前需求扭矩。
9.一种发动机喷油量计算装置,其特征在于,所述装置包括扭矩计算模块,判断模块以及第一喷油量计算模块, 所述扭矩计算模块用于计算发动机当前需求扭矩; 所述判断模块用于判断扭矩计算模块计算出的当前需求扭矩是否小于扭矩/油量转换MAP图的最小标定扭矩,或者大于扭矩/油量转换MAP图的最大标定扭矩,如果是,则通知所述第一喷油量计算模块; 所述第一喷油量计算模块用于接收到判断模块的通知后,根据扭矩/油量转换MAP图中的两点的需求扭矩和喷油量的对应关系,利用正相关线性算法计算出当前需求扭矩对应的喷油量;其中,所述两点中的一点为与当前需求扭矩最近的标定扭矩。
10.根据权利要求9所述的装置,其特征在于,所述装置还包括第二喷油量计算模块, 所述判断模块还用于当判断扭矩计算模块计算出的当前需求扭矩是否小于扭矩/油量转换MAP图的最小标定扭矩,或者大于扭矩/油量转换MAP图的最大标定扭矩的判断结果为否时,则通知第二喷油量计算模块; 所述第二喷油量计算模块用于接收到判断模块的通知后,根据扭矩/油量转换MAP图计算出当前需求扭矩对应的喷油量。
全文摘要
本发明提供了一种发动机喷油量计算方法及装置,所述方法包括计算发动机当前需求扭矩;判断当前需求扭矩是否小于扭矩/油量转换MAP图的最小标定扭矩,或者大于扭矩/油量转换MAP图的最大标定扭矩,如果是,则根据扭矩/油量转换MAP图中两点的需求扭矩和喷油量的对应关系,利用正相关线性算法计算出当前需求扭矩对应的喷油量。当发动机当前需求扭矩小于最小标定扭矩时,利用本发明的方法计算出的喷油量小于最小标定扭矩对应的喷油量,并且当发动机当前需求扭矩大于最大标定扭矩时,利用本发明的方法计算出的喷油量大于最大标定扭矩对应的喷油量。本发明计算的喷油量更加合理,从而减少了易出现的发动机怠速不稳或者是发动机熄火的问题。
文档编号G06F19/00GK103020465SQ201210570789
公开日2013年4月3日 申请日期2012年12月24日 优先权日2012年12月24日
发明者王秀雷, 孟媛媛, 桑海浪, 董秀云 申请人:潍柴动力股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1